The Initiative Idea:

The guardian monitors their son’s performance in the daily tasks schedule during the blessed month of Ramadan.

The Mechanism:

After registering for the initiative, a daily tasks schedule file will be sent to the student throughout the blessed month of Ramadan. It includes obligatory prayers, performing the recommended Sunnah prayers, Quran recitation, Dhuha prayer, Taraweeh prayer, and good manners. Parents will be asked to place the schedule in a noticeable place at home and monitor their child’s performance of these tasks daily. Additionally, parents will be requested to send a report of their child’s performance during the initiative, and students will be rewarded at the end of the month if they achieve a high completion rate.

The Objectives:

  1. Activating the role of families in monitoring their children’s daily activities.
  2. Adhering to the Sunnah and daily obligations that contribute to building the character of a Muslim.
  3. Instilling a spirit of competition for good among students.

The Outcomes:

  1. Enhancing interaction and family bonding between parents and their children.
  2. Instilling a love for adherence to Sunnah and religious obligations in Muslim youth
